'Somewhere' is the first album of material from the late Eva Cassidy to be released in five years. It features twelve previously unreleased recordings and includes the only known recorded songs co-written by Eva.

"It was clear that fans of Eva's music wanted a new album but it was important to us that any new record was made up of songs that had not been heard before and that were of a high quality. We are really pleased with the album; it is long overdue"
- Eva's father, Hugh Cassidy

Tracks:

1. Coat Of Many Colours - the Dolly Parton song with Eva's acoustic guitar / vocal to the fore.

2. My Love Is Like A Red Red Rose - Acoustic recording of the well-known traditional folk song arranged and sung by Eva.

3. Ain't Doin' Too Bad - Eva really lets rip on this song that has had new backing tracks added to her original "live" at Blues Alley performance.

4. Chain Of Fools - Eva is at her most soulful on this classic Aretha Franklin hit; new horn arrangements and backing vocals from the Tremain sisters.

5. Won't Be Long - the original tapes by Eva and her regular band from 1993 were discovered by Eva's guitarist, Keith Grimes.

6. Walkin' After Midnight - a Texas swing version of the Patsy Cline standard was originally recorded by Eva and her band in 1993.

7. Early One Morning - the popular English folk song originally recorded with her old school friend Rob Cooper in 1987. Rob plays Dobro and Electric lap steel guitar and Eva carries both the lead and backing vocals.

8. A Bold Young Farmer - another old folk song recorded by Eva at her boyfriend, Chris Biondo's studio in 1995. Eva's gorgeous vocals and acoustic guitar are all that is needed.

9. If I Give My Heart - Eva's brother, Dan Cassidy, recently came forward with this duet: Eva carries vocals and guitar and Dan plays a mean fiddle. Recorded at Sudio Stef in Iceland (!!!!!) in 1994.

10. Blue Eyes Crying In The Rain - originally a big hit for Willie Nelson, Eva adds her own vocal magic in this acoustic studio perfomance from 1995.

11. Summertime - Eva Cassidy makes this Gershwin classic her own with a lovely acoustic studio performance.

12. Somewhere - written by Eva and Chris Biondo in 1990 but the studio session was incomplete. Chris finished the track in 2008 in the style that it was originally conceived by Eva and Chris. One of the album's highlights.
